mar. Mai 13th, 2025
découvrez notre guide complet pour débuter avec bootstrap en 2025. apprenez les fondamentaux du framework, explorez des astuces pratiques et créez des sites web réactifs facilement grâce à des exemples clairs et des conseils d'experts.

Bootstrap en 2025 offre des solutions modernes pour le dĂ©veloppement Web et le webdesign. Ce guide partage des retours d’expĂ©rience concrets pour maĂ®triser ce framework CSS leader en crĂ©ation d’interfaces responsives.

L’outil simplifie l’intĂ©gration du responsive design. Il permet la crĂ©ation d’interfaces Ă©lĂ©gantes via HTML/CSS et JavaScript.

A retenir :

  • Bootstrap simplifie la crĂ©ation d’interfaces modernes
  • Installation via CDN, npm ou tĂ©lĂ©chargement direct
  • Le système de grille permet un design adaptatif
  • Personnalisation avancĂ©e avec des variables CSS natives

Pourquoi Bootstrap domine le développement Web en 2025 ?

Bootstrap est le framework front-end privilégié des développeurs. Son évolution demeure essentielle pour le responsive design.

Les outils et les templates Bootstrap offrent des retours d’expĂ©rience encourageants. Un tĂ©moignage d’une start-up affirme :

« L’implĂ©mentation de Bootstrap a facilitĂ© la phase de prototypage de notre application. »

Jenny, fondatrice de Novatech

Installation et configuration de Bootstrap

L’installation se fait via CDN, gestionnaires ou tĂ©lĂ©chargement. Chaque mĂ©thode s’adapte aux besoins diffĂ©rents. Des retours d’expĂ©rience soulignent la facilitĂ© d’intĂ©gration par CDN.

Pour des projets complexes, npm simplifie la gestion des modules. Un avis d’un dĂ©veloppeur confirme ce choix avec succès.

  • CDN: rapide et simple
  • npm/yarn: gestionnaire de dĂ©pendances moderne
  • TĂ©lĂ©chargement direct: version complète
  • Documentation dĂ©taillĂ©e: support communautaire
A lire :  Les meilleures fonctionnalitĂ©s cachĂ©es de Firefox que vous devez connaĂ®tre
MéthodeAvantagesInconvénients
CDNMise en place rapide, mise à jour automatiqueDépendance à une connexion externe
npm/yarnInstallation modulable, gestion facile des versionsConfiguration initiale requise
Téléchargement directAccès complet aux fichiersMise à jour manuelle nécessaire

Exemples concrets d’installation et utilisation

J’ai mis en place un projet avec tĂ©lĂ©chargement direct. Le setup initial a pris moins de 10 minutes.

Un collègue a prĂ©fĂ©rĂ© l’installation via npm pour la gestion automatisĂ©e. Ces expĂ©riences montrent la flexibilitĂ© du framework CSS.

  • MĂ©thode CDN: configuration en quelques lignes
  • MĂ©thode npm: intĂ©gration dans un workflow complet
  • Documentation accessible: aide sur chaque Ă©tape
  • Support communautaire: forums et tutoriels abondants
MĂ©thodeTemps d’installationAdaptabilitĂ©
CDNTrès courtAdapté aux petits projets
npm/yarnModéréParfait pour les projets évolutifs
Téléchargement directVariableIdéal pour une personnalisation poussée

Comprendre le système de grille et le responsive design

La grille Bootstrap est le pilier du responsive design. Elle offre une structure fluide adaptée à tous les écrans.

Les expĂ©riences de rĂ©alisations personnelles prouvent la simplicitĂ© de la mise en page. Chaque composant s’intègre harmonieusement pour un UI/UX design optimal.

Structure de base de la grille Bootstrap

La grille se compose de conteneurs, lignes et colonnes. Cette structure assure une flexibilité pour le développement Web.

  • Conteneur: dĂ©limite le contenu
  • Ligne: organise les colonnes horizontalement
  • Colonne: contient le contenu et s’adapte Ă  l’Ă©cran
  • Système 12 colonnes: standard de rĂ©partition
ÉlémentFonctionExemple pratique
ConteneurDéfinition de la largeur.container ou .container-fluid
LigneOrganisation horizontale.row
ColonneDisposition des éléments.col-*

Points de rupture et adaptabilité mobile-first

Bootstrap définit plusieurs points de rupture pour les écrans. Chaque breakpoint ajuste la mise en page automatiquement.

  • Extra small: pour petits Ă©crans
  • Small: Ă©crans mobiles standards
  • Medium: tablettes et petits ordinateurs
  • Large: ordinateurs de bureau
A lire :  Avantages du SGML pour les publications scientifiques
BreakpointPréfixeDimension
Extra small.col-<576px
Small.col-sm-≥576px
Medium.col-md-≥768px
Large.col-lg-≥992px

Personnalisation et optimisation avec Bootstrap

Bootstrap est hautement personnalisable grâce aux variables CSS. La personnalisation offre un UI/UX design adapté à chaque projet.

Les retours d’expĂ©rience montrent que l’ajustement des thèmes amĂ©liore la cohĂ©rence visuelle. Un avis d’un designer explique :

« La flexibilitĂ© des variables CSS m’a permis de crĂ©er un design Ă  mon image. »

Marc, designer UI/UX

Utilisation des variables CSS et thèmes

Les variables CSS facilitent la modification des couleurs et des polices. Le système de thèmes permet d’adapter l’apparence.

  • Variables CSS: ajustement des couleurs
  • Thèmes personnalisĂ©s: variantes claires et sombres
  • Utilisation simple: surcharge rapide
  • Adaptation visuelle: correspondance avec votre identitĂ©
OptionAvantageExemple
Variable CSSModification rapide–bs-primary: #3498db
Thème sombreAffichage moderneBasé sur préférences utilisateur
Thème clairConfort de lecturePalette de couleurs douces

Optimiser les performances des pages web

Optimiser Bootstrap améliore la vitesse de chargement. Des techniques modernes limitent le chargement du code non utilisé.

  • Chargement sĂ©lectif: importer uniquement les composants nĂ©cessaires
  • Purge des styles: nettoyage du CSS
  • Lazy loading: chargement Ă  la demande des scripts
  • Outils d’optimisation: rĂ©duction de la taille des assets
MéthodeAvantageImpact
Chargement sélectifMoins de code inutileTemps de chargement réduit
PurgeCSSNettoyage du CSSFichiers plus légers
Lazy loadingScripts chargés à la demandeNavigation plus fluide

Intégration avec frameworks et accessibilité en développement Web

Bootstrap s’intègre aux frameworks modernes tels que React et Angular. Cet outil renforce la productivitĂ© du dĂ©veloppement Web.

A lire :  Pourquoi adopter Bootstrap pour vos projets de dĂ©veloppement web ?

L’intĂ©gration avec des bibliothèques permet d’enrichir l’expĂ©rience utilisateur. Un tĂ©moignage utilisateur indique :

« L’utilisation de BootstrapVue a grandement facilitĂ© mes projets en Vue.js. »

Sophie, développeuse front-end

Compatibilité avec frameworks JavaScript

Bootstrap fonctionne avec React, Vue.js et Angular. Les composants sont adaptés à chaque environnement.

  • React Bootstrap: intĂ©gration native
  • BootstrapVue: solutions pour Vue.js
  • ng-bootstrap: composants Angular
  • Support communautaire: documentation riche
FrameworkLibrairie associéeAvantage
ReactReact BootstrapComposants natifs
Vue.jsBootstrapVueIntégration simplifiée
Angularng-bootstrapAdaptĂ© Ă  l’Ă©cosystème Angular

Bonnes pratiques pour l’accessibilitĂ© et UI/UX design

Bootstrap intègre des outils pour rendre les sites accessibles. Chaque site profite d’une navigation fluide pour tous les utilisateurs.

  • Attributs ARIA: amĂ©lioration de l’accessibilitĂ©
  • Contraste de couleurs: respect des normes
  • Navigation au clavier: interface conviviale
  • Tests utilisateurs: vĂ©rification de l’ergonomie
AspectSolutionExemple d’implĂ©mentation
AccessibilitéAttributs ARIABalises adaptées
VisibilitéContraste optimiséRespect des WCAG
InteractivitéNavigation au clavierFocus visible

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*